"A current threat to academic freedom in the classroom comes from a demand that teachers provide warnings in advance if assigned material contains anything that might trigger difficult emotional responses for students. This follows from earlier calls not to offend students’ sensibilities by introducing material that challenges their values and beliefs."
On Trigger Warnings | AAUP "SANTA BARBARA, Calif. — Should students about to read “The Great Gatsby” be forewarned about “a variety of scenes that reference gory, abusive and misogynistic violence,” as one Rutgers student proposed? Would any book that addresses racism — like “The Adventures of Huckleberry Finn” or “Things Fall Apart” — have to be preceded by a note of caution? Do sexual images from Greek mythology need to come with a viewer-beware label? Colleges across the country this spring have been wrestling with student requests for what are known as “trigger warnings,” explicit alerts that the material they are about to read or see in a classroom might upset them or, as some students assert, cause symptoms of post-traumatic stress disorder in victims of rape or in war veterans." http://www.nytimes.com/2014/05/18/us...uirm.html?_r=0 "The political left has come up with a new buzzword: “micro-aggression.” Professors at UC Berkeley have been officially warned against saying such things as “America is the land of opportunity.” Why? Because this is considered to be an act of “micro-aggression” against minorities and women. Supposedly it shows that you don’t take their grievances seriously and are therefore guilty of being aggressive toward them, even if only on a micro scale." http://www.nytimes.com/2014/05/18/us...uirm.html?_r=0 "CAMBRIDGE, Mass. — A tone-deaf inquiry into an Asian-American’s ethnic origin. Cringe-inducing praise for how articulate a black student is. An unwanted conversation about a Latino’s ability to speak English without an accent. This is not exactly the language of traditional racism, but in an avalanche of blogs, student discourse, campus theater and academic papers, they all reflect the murky terrain of the social justice word du jour — microaggressions — used to describe the subtle ways that racial, ethnic, gender and other stereotypes can play out painfully in an increasingly diverse culture. http://www.nytimes.com/2014/03/22/us...ill-sting.html I am being convinced that many on here do not even realize what is happening in our schools and around the country. And in elementary school as well.....
"St. Paul's Frost Lake Elementary has focused intensely on its black students lately. Administrators and teachers pore over data and ask: If black students make up 20 percent of the student body, why do they account for 65 percent of the suspensions? Why do they lag behind peers in reading and math? The school's "equity team" is an offshoot of the district's three-year relationship with San Francisco-based consultant Pacific Educational Group, or PEG. The premise: Educators can only chip away at achievement disparities if they confront their own racial biases and the ways racism permeates schools. "We are asking our staff to change rather than expect kids to change to fit our comfort level -- and that's huge," said Frost Lake Principal Stacey Kadrmas. PEG's input has spurred districtwide changes in St. Paul, from a push to reduce suspensions to a bid to integrate students with intensive special needs into mainstream classrooms. Districts such as Edina examined reading selections, hallway posters and curriculums to ensure they include faces and voices with whom students of color can identify. Critics say PEG's work has alienated some educators and, in recasting certain discipline issues as cultural misunderstandings, let disruptive students and their families off the hook. Some point to the cost of PEG's services and the scarcity of solid evidence they boost achievement.
